    Any information would be appreciated. Thanks in advance.You have a character set 1 and a character set 2. You assume that you have a character that is in set 1 which also has a representation in set 2.
    If in fact there is such a mapping then you simply look for the characters in the source, look the mapping up, and the write out to a new location replacing the old character (data) with the new.
    The first step of course is identifying explicitly what character set 1 and set 2 are. Then you find something that has a full representation of each of those. And then you map, manually, from one to the other.
    Note that in the above there is in fact the possiblity that there is no mapping. And actually since it appears that you have used tools that map many characters but not this one then it is likely that this is exactly the case.

  • It's possible to convert 'WE8MSWIN1252' character to chinese character set?

    Hi All,
    Is anyone know how to convert "WE8MSWIN1252" character to chinese character set in order to display chinese word in oracle apex?
    My problem is i can't display chinese character set in oracle apex. The chinese field is showed like °×ѪÇò¼ÆÊý. I'm using WE8MSWIN1252 database character set.
    I'm wondering it's possible to show character word?
    I'm appreciating if anyone have a good solution to share with me.
    Thanks a lot in advance!
    Edited by: Apex Junior on Jul 16, 2010 2:18 PM

    WE8 is a Western European character set. If you wish to store and access a globalized multibyte character set you must have a database that supports it: You don't have one at the moment.
    Given this is Apex I'd suggest you read the docs and reinstall.
    Alternatively you could try CSSCAN and CSALTER and perhaps you can make the change but be very careful and have a good backup before you try.

    I think this is a dirty great bug in the Sun version of the apache Xerces classes that were bundled with jdk1.5.
    I've had similar problems, and it seems to boil down to the fact that the NamespaceSupport class's getURI method does == instead of .equals when looking up the uri for a particular prefix. I'm told that this is a deliberate feature for the Apache stuff, and that the class assumes interned strings or strings that have gone through their internal SymbolTable mechanism, and that I can work around it by using interned strings. However, it is one of their classes that fails to intern the string (or put it through the symbol table etc.), so that doesn't really make sense as there are no hooks into this stuff.
    They have even marked the bug as closed/fixed, and I'm attempting to re-raise it at present (so it'll be fixed in about ten years then).

    Accessing a Connection Pool from a Java Class
    Applications that are deployed to servers often need to access databases that reside on remote machines. You therefore have to set up a JDBC connection pool the server that points to the database. You then create a data source that connects to the connection pool and use the data source's JNDI name to acquire a connection to the database.
    To access a database from an enterprise application:
    1. (Optional) Create a service locator class to handle getting the reference to the database.
    2. Open the Java file from which you want to access the database. In the Source Editor, right-click the file and choose Enterprise Resources > Use Database.
    3. Enter a JNDI name for the database connection. This name must be the same as the JNDI name of the JDBC data source for the database on the target server.
    If you are deploying to the Sun Java System Application Server, you can also generate a connection pool and data source for the database connection by selecting the Create Server Resources checkbox. The resources are created under the project's Server Resources node.
    4. Select the database to which you want to connect in the Connection drop-down list. If the database is not listed, do the following:
    i) If the JDBC driver for the database server is not registered in the IDE, click Add Driver.
    ii) Click Add Connection to connect to the database.
    5. Under Service Locator Strategy, specify whether to generate inline lookup code or use an existing service locator. You can click the Browse to search for the service locator class name.
    6. Click OK.
    The Use Database command is only available in EJB module and web application projects.
